1. Cost Savings:
One of the primary motivations for DIY ceramic coating is cost savings. Professional ceramic coating services can be expensive, with prices ranging from hundreds to thousands of dollars depending on the vehicle and coating package. DIY ceramic coating kits are often more affordable, allowing car enthusiasts to achieve professional-grade results at a fraction of the cost.

5. Potential Drawbacks:
Despite its appeal, DIY ceramic coating comes with its fair share of challenges and potential drawbacks. The application process requires careful preparation, meticulous attention to detail, and proper technique to achieve optimal results. Additionally, mistakes during the application process can lead to uneven coverage, streaks, and other cosmetic imperfections that detract from the overall finish.
